Abstract

Freedom of the press is another side of press accountability. The press must obey the ethics of the press profession regulated by the press organization. Meanwhile, journalistic work is within the corridor of laws and regulations governing the press. On the one hand, the press works in the spirit of freedom, on the other hand, the press also demands accountability. This study shows that the Indonesian press was free after the end of the Soeharto Authoritarian Government. However, the gift of press freedom was also faced with various violations of the ethics of the press profession, which led to legal problems. The researcher used a normative legal research methodology. This study uses a normative research methodology. This study concludes that in addition to "freedom of the press", journalistic work is also required to obey the ethics of the journalistic profession regulated by the press organization.
